Average base salary Data source tooltip for average base salary. $93,699. same. as national average. … WebFeb 19, 2024 · The SBA 7 (a) loan is the most commonly used loan program and is incredibly flexible. It can be used for working capital, equipment, and owner-occupied commercial real estate. WebMar 10, 2024 · Sellers and real estate professionals must disclose all known defects and hazards on a property. While a seller needs to be truthful, their agent also needs to investigate to make sure all known hazards and defects are fully disclosed to potential buyers.
